Beautifully coloured chromo-lithographic plate from 1895 with detailed illustrations of 14 fish species including the Great white shark (Carcharias vulgaris), the porcupine fish (Diodon tigrinus) and seahorse (Hippocampus). This plate originates from 'Wagner's Natuurlijk Historie', a book about natural history which was originally written by the German biologist Herman Wagner and translated into Dutch by D. Horn.
